Output 95c5269e4a673100379b8ce1da7e216da87353debe0b816b148f03180472b5cb:0

value
1855751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fe8ba42bd3bb6aa0751bf36914774eea93560ae OP_EQUAL
address
3EowMAtXDiBDTgN4MEcUmFz9PhQcUrzDhA
transaction
95c5269e4a673100379b8ce1da7e216da87353debe0b816b148f03180472b5cb
confirmations
207259
spent
true